The School of Technology (SOTECH) of the University of the Philippines Visayas (UPV) took a significant step towards shaping its future by holding a Strategic Planning Workshop for 2025–2027 at Hotel del Rio, Iloilo City. The two-day workshop brought together faculty and staff to craft a focused and forward-looking roadmap aligned with the UP System’s broader strategic framework for 2023–2029.
